The story behind this photo of a dog is just heartbreaking

So emotional! - by Kathryn Lewsey
  • 21 Jun 2019

A photo of a dog waiting by his owner’s bed has gone viral for heartbreaking reasons.

In the snap, Moose from New Jersey, can be seen patiently sitting at his ‘Dad’s’ bed.

The story behind this photo of a dog is just heartbreaking
Facebook

But tragically, unbeknown to him, the loyal pooch’s owner passed away this week.

Eleventh Hour Rescue shelter shared the post on their Facebook page, writing, ‘(Moose was) waiting for him to return, not knowing that ‘Dad had passed away. He’s a sweet happy boy by nature. He just needs people to help his heart heal.’

The rescue shelter added that the Labrador cross was ‘taking the loss of his dad pretty hard.’

‘Please help us heal his heart,’ they added.

Moses
Facebook

Tugging on heartstrings, the emotional post has been shared over 2,500 times over the past two days.

Moose, who is affectionately known as ‘The Moosinator’, was described as a very loveable pooch.

‘So much so that Moose would do best in a home where he wasn’t left home alone all day long, he misses his people too much,’ the shelter added.

The shelter has already received several applications for the cute canine, with NorthStar Pet Rescue announcing on social media, ‘We are hopeful he will find a forever home soon! Thank you for caring & sharing everyone!’
